Details

GREAT OUSEBURN MAIN STREET SE 4461-4561 (north-east side) 9/12 Well Farm House GV II House. Late C17-early C18; extended, modernised and front rebuilt c.1970. Timber-framed, with infill of red brick in stretcher bond; pantile roof. 2-storey, 4-bay front. (Entrance in extension porch in right return.) Front windows are 3-light, small-paned casements with brick sills. Left end and right-of-centre stacks. Interior: three pairs of jowled posts survive, some with curved braces. Fireplace in room to left of door has chamfer-stopped bressummer which extends to form door arch. Doorway retains one chamfer-stopped jamb. Studded rear wall. Harrison, B, and Hutton, B, Vernacular Houses in N.Yorkshire and Cleveland, pp.35, 123 and 124; fig.7.2.
